Back Pain Management Yoga Training Actually Gives Better Relief Than Chiropractic

Study from the U.K. reports that a 12-week basic yoga group training program improves back function more than exercise and manipulation, cognitive-behavior treatment and six sessions of 1-to-1 Alexander technique.

Correct Posture Helps Relieve Neck and Back Pain

Better ergonomics the key to long-term neck and back pain relief says University of Maryland.

Citing statistics that show two-thirds of dentists suffer chronic back and neck pain, new classes and ergonomic training are now “Required” classwork for all dental students.

Cymbalta Appears to Stimulate Development of New Brain Cells

New research (April, 2011) from the U.K. (Britain) shows that duloxetine stimulates and speeds the growth of brain nerve stem cells, a process that is normally stunted by chronic pain and depression.

Duloxetine – Effective Back Pain Relief

New FDA approval was granted in November, 2010 for once-a-day oral treatment of chronic pain in the bones, joints and muscles – including the lower back. Back Pain Caused by Subluxed Sacro-Iliac Joint

It’s been estimated that up to 15-20% of low back pain comes from the hip or sacroiliac joint. This is especially true if your pain is associated with a felt “Pop!” and sudden pain.
